The winter stars
The winter sky has always brought me an irreplaceable sense of tangible wonder Only this time, it was the stringing of melted words that I had been left to ponder Even as the night grew longer and I simultaneously ticked away with the earth, the steady beauty portrayed by the daggers which orbited above me- In the silence and chill Awed my fear into extinction (C) Tiffanie Doro
